Article Title Paeoniflorin inhibits human gastric carcinoma cell proliferation through up-regulation microRNA-124 and suppression of PI3K/Akt and STAT3 signaling

Key Words Gastric cancer; Paeoniflorin; MicroRNA-124; Phosphatidylinositol 3-kinase; Akt; Signal transducer and activator of transcription 3
Core Tip The in vitro data suggests that paeoniflorinis is a potential novel therapeutic agent against gastric carcinoma, which inhibits cell viability and induces apoptosis through the up-regulation of microRNA-124 and suppression of phosphatidylinositol 3-kinase/Akt signaling.
